Discover X2 Kui Buri, designed for the spirit...

Opened on December 2007, X2 Kui Buri, the first of the X2 resorts, was designed as an oasis of serenity, intimacy, and bespoke experiences, equally enjoyable for an active holiday or relaxing retreat. X2 allows you to cross to (X2) a whole new dimension of designed luxury and to experience life as it should be.

Kui Buri is a 3 hours drive south of Bangkok, and half an hour south of the famous beachside resort town of Hua Hin "where the Thai royal family frequently reside". The general area is underdeveloped and peaceful with the only communities being local fishing villages.

The resort is located on virgin beachfront land covering over 4 acres (12 Rai).

The existing landscape of large, well developed trees has been carefully preserved, and provides a unique atmosphere punctuated by large open spaces and unique natural horticulture.

Featuring a contemporary style decor, X2 Kui Buri offers guests 23 unique high design villas: 19 private pool villas and 4 private garden villas. The villas at X2 Kui Buri have their own terrace, garden and most with private pools.
